GEF-B Dividend FAQ
As of July 2026, GEF-B's dividend yield is 4.55%. This is calculated by dividing the trailing 12-month dividend rate (TTM rate) of 3.44 USD by the current share price of 100.41.
As of July 2026, GEF-B paid a dividend of 3.44 USD in the last 12 months. The last dividend was paid on 2026-06-17 and the payout was 0.93 USD.
GEF-B pays dividends quarterly. Over the last 12 months, GEF-B has issued 4 dividend payments. The last dividend payment was made on 2026-06-17.
Based on historical data, the forecasted dividends per share for GEF-B for the next payments are between 0.92 (-1.1%) and 1.023 (+10.0%). This suggests the dividend will remain relatively stable. The expected Yield for the next 12 months is about 3.89%.
The latest dividend paid per share was 0.93 USD with an Ex-Dividend Date of 2026-06-17. The next Ex-Dividend date for Greif (GEF-B) is currently unknown.
The next Ex-Dividend date for Greif (GEF-B) is currently unknown. We automatically update the next Ex-Dividend date when it is announced.
GEF-B's average dividend growth rate over the past 5 years is 4.90% per year. Strong growth: GEF-B's dividend growth is outpacing inflation.
GEF-B's 5-Year Yield on Cost is 7.08%. If you bought GEF-B's shares at 48.57 USD five years ago, your current annual dividend income (3.44 USD per share, trailing 12 months) equals 7.08% of your original purchase price.
